FEEDBACK & YOUR PERFORMANCE
(Must Read)
Ken Blanchard say "Feedback is the breakfast of Champion."
What is behind you cannot be seen by you until someone inform you about it. No matter how smart you are, you can't see it all.
I could remember when I started writing my articles, people will direct my attention to some of the errors I made in those articles. Up till now, I still have them around me. They watches my back & correct my mistakes. Today I am happy for having them around me.
How often do you listen to the responses you gotten from people?
You can not improve in your career, life or in your performance without listening to what people are saying about you. Listening does not mean doing - Note this please.
Don't join those sets of people that says words like "I am me I don't give a damn on what people say about me, I don't care what you think of me, if you don't like me, get the hell out" & many other statements related to that.
Sure it's cool to be yourself. It's the best thing you can do for yourself. But you have the right to improve yourself.
You shut off feedback when you believed that you don't need anyone to talk to you. What a pity! Continue living that mediocrity life.
Listen, what they says about you is your feedback. It's a pointer.
The feedback can either be positive or negative. But no matter what, you can use any of the two to your advantage.
Listen & understand what you got from people towards your actions. Allow people to grade your performance & ask them what to do in other to increase your performance or improve it.
It's an advantage, don't ignore it. You can't know it all. Some will tell you & if they don't, ask. It maybe your colleague, boss, or your audience, allow them to say something about your performance though it depend on your relationship with them. If the feedback is good appreciate it, if it's negative ask for how to improve it. That's the deal.
You will be surprised by seeing the loopholes in your actions. By doing this, you will surely improve in your performance.
You can't know it all. You are too innocent to believe that you are good enough. Allow people to probe your behaviour. Allow them to criticize you. Don't shut them off. Ask them questions & use it for your advantage.
Bave you been evaluating your performances? If not, learn it & engage it. FOR it will increase your productivity.
